Kansas Relays Yields Strong Results for Billikens
LAWRENCE, Kan. – Saint Louis posted a number of positive results at this weekend's Kansas Relays, hosted by the University of Kansas at Rock Chalk Park in Lawrence. Libby Williams posted a big PR in the hammer throw, reaching 50.24 meters for the second-best mark in program history. Journey Amundson won the triple jump (12.77 meters) and placed second in the long jump (5.86 meters). Emery Mayfield won the 5,000 meters with a time of 17:42.11 in windy conditions.
